2008年,谷歌的聯(lián)合創(chuàng)始人謝爾蓋?布爾發(fā)現(xiàn),他身體的每一個(gè)細(xì)胞都有LRRK2的基因突變。LRRK2是一種基因突變,這個(gè)基因可能引起帕金森病發(fā)的病機(jī)率較高。也就是每個(gè)帕金森氏癥患者都有LRRK2突變,也不是每個(gè)有LRRK2突變的人都會(huì)得帕金森氏癥。但是,如果一個(gè)人的細(xì)胞中有LRRK2的基因突變,他一生中得到帕金森氏癥的機(jī)率會(huì)增加30%到75%。相較之下,一個(gè)普通美國(guó)人患帕金森氏癥的風(fēng)險(xiǎn)大約是1%。
布爾使用一組大數(shù)據(jù)做了他自己的研究,并得出結(jié)論,如果他不采取任何行動(dòng)來(lái)減少帕金森氏癥,他有50%的機(jī)會(huì)患上帕金森氏癥。得出這個(gè)結(jié)論后,布爾開(kāi)了一個(gè)部落客,這個(gè)部落客就命名為「LRRK2」。布爾還向媒體透露了這個(gè)消息。他的作法是希望藉此引起這方面的專家注意,甚至為他提供解決辦法。
此外,他還自己研究了LRRK2突變?cè)谌梭w的影像,他要自己找到方法,以降低自己得到帕金森氏癥的機(jī)會(huì)。
在他的研究中,他發(fā)現(xiàn)運(yùn)動(dòng),尤其是潛水的年輕人,可以降低60%患帕金森氏癥的幾率。此后,一周中總有幾個(gè)晚上,布爾在一天的工作后,就開(kāi)車上路到當(dāng)?shù)氐挠斡境亍T谀抢铮麚Q上泳褲,走到一個(gè)3米長(zhǎng)的跳板上,看著下面的水,然后潛水,然后開(kāi)始跳水。
布爾還嘗試涉足瑜伽、體操和搏擊。他嘗試了很多事來(lái)鍛煉自己的身體和精神。他說(shuō);「潛水本身很短暫,但很激烈」,他補(bǔ)充說(shuō):「你用力推開(kāi)水,然后必須馬上扭轉(zhuǎn)過(guò)來(lái)。它確實(shí)讓你的心率加快了。」
其他研究表明,攝取咖啡因與降低帕金森氏癥風(fēng)險(xiǎn)也有幫助。所以,有一段時(shí)間,布爾每天喝一兩杯咖啡。但他不習(xí)慣咖啡的味道。于是他改喝綠茶。每次泳池鍛煉身體時(shí),他就喝一杯綠茶,他希望透過(guò)生活方式來(lái)降低遺傳對(duì)他的影響。
「這一切都是現(xiàn)成的,」他說(shuō);「但假設(shè)根據(jù)飲食、鍛煉等因素,我可以將風(fēng)險(xiǎn)降低一半,降至 25% 左右。」
布爾說(shuō),通過(guò)飲食、運(yùn)動(dòng)等綜合考慮,他希望將風(fēng)險(xiǎn)降低一半,從50%左右降低到25%。然后,隨著神經(jīng)科學(xué)的穩(wěn)步發(fā)展,布爾希望將他的風(fēng)險(xiǎn)再降低一半,使他患帕金森氏癥的總體機(jī)會(huì)降到13%左右。
大約在那個(gè)時(shí)候,布爾還捐贈(zèng)了超過(guò)5000萬(wàn)美元,來(lái)開(kāi)發(fā)或研究可能的藥物治療,甚至帕金森氏癥的治療方法。他希望這筆錢足以「發(fā)揮作用」。(當(dāng)時(shí),布爾的凈資產(chǎn)為150億美元。
但布爾并沒(méi)有就此止步。他想把他的風(fēng)險(xiǎn)降低到「10%以下」。雖然百分之十仍然比平均風(fēng)險(xiǎn)高十倍,但他最初的機(jī)會(huì)減少了五倍(即從50%下降到10%)。這離降低得病的機(jī)會(huì)還有很長(zhǎng)的路要走。
我的一位醫(yī)生朋友曾經(jīng)說(shuō)過(guò);病人不需要把他們的命運(yùn)交給醫(yī)生。他的意思是;照顧身體是病人自己的責(zé)任屬,而不是他的醫(yī)生。醫(yī)生的作用是提供專業(yè)意見(jiàn)供病人參考。
布爾寫道:「我很幸運(yùn)提早發(fā)現(xiàn)我很容易得到帕金森病」。「我現(xiàn)在有機(jī)會(huì)調(diào)整我的生活以減少得病的機(jī)率(例如,有證據(jù)表明運(yùn)動(dòng)可能對(duì)帕金森病有保護(hù)作用)。我也有機(jī)會(huì)在這種疾病可能影響我之前,就開(kāi)始進(jìn)行和支持對(duì)它的研究。而且,不管我自己的健康如何,它都能幫助我的家人和其他人。」
當(dāng)然,即使布爾什么都不做,他可能也不會(huì)得帕金森氏癥。但我們不應(yīng)該這樣想。最好假設(shè);如果我們什么都不做,沒(méi)有設(shè)法嘗試降低風(fēng)險(xiǎn)或讓它延遲發(fā)病,最壞的情況就是會(huì)發(fā)生。這樣,即使我們確實(shí)生病了,我們也不會(huì)有任何遺憾。
布爾在面對(duì)他的潛在疾病時(shí)表現(xiàn)出積極主動(dòng)的態(tài)度。當(dāng)我們面臨潛在的問(wèn)題和實(shí)際問(wèn)題時(shí),我們可以從他的例子中學(xué)習(xí)。我們應(yīng)該嘗試估計(jì)風(fēng)險(xiǎn),并盡我們所能降低風(fēng)險(xiǎn)。同樣,如果我們能做任何事情來(lái)增加成功的可能性,我們就應(yīng)該這樣做,以改善我們的生活。最后,我們的協(xié)同努力可以大大有助于避免問(wèn)題或增加我們成功的可能性。
Using a Positive Attitude to Face Problems
In 2008, Sergey Brin, Google’s co-founder, found that there were LRRK2 mutations in every cell of his body. LRRK2 is a genetic mutation which is linked to a higher rate of Parkinson’s disease. Not everyone with Parkinson's has the LRRK2 mutation, and not everyone with the LRRK2 mutation will get Parkinson’s. However, if one has the LRRK2 mutation, it means that one’s chance of getting Parkinson's is between 30 to 75 percent in one’s lifetime. For reference, the risk of an average American getting Parkinson’s is about one percent.
Brin did his own research using a large data set and concluded that he had a 50 percent chance of developing Parkinson’s if he didn’t do anything to curtail it. After this conclusion, Brin started a blog that was simply called “LRRK2.” He also told the media about his blog in order to try to attract experts to provide solutions for his reference.
In addition, he also studied the LRRK2 mutation in humans to try to find ways to reduce the chances of developing Parkinson's.
In his research, he learned of one study that found that young men who do exercise, especially diving, can reduce their chances of getting Parkinson's by 60 percent. So, several evenings of a week, Brin drives up the road to the local pool after a day’s work. There, he changes into his swim trunks, steps out onto a 3-meter springboard, peers at the water below, and dives into it.
Brin also tried to dabble in yoga, gymnastics and acrobatics. He tried many things to exert himself physically and mentally. But about the diving, he said, “The dive itself is brief but intense,” adding “You push off really hard and then have to twist right away. It does get your heart rate going.”
Other studies have shown that caffeine consumption is linked to a reduced risk of Parkinson’s. So, for a time, Brin drank one or two cups of coffee a day. But he couldn’t stand or get used to the taste of the coffee. So he switched to green tea.
With every pool workout and every cup of tea, he hopes to diminish his risk of getting Parkinson’s, counteracting his genetic predisposition with lifestyle changes.
Brin said that with a combination of diet, exercise, and so on, he hopes to cut his lifetime risk of developing Parkinson’s by half, from about 50 percent to 25 percent. Then, with the steady progress of neuroscience, Brin hopes that his risk will be cut in half again—bringing his overall chance of developing Parkinson's to around 13 percent.
Around that time, Brin also donated over US$50.00M to develop or investigate possible drug treatments or even cures for Parkinson’s. He hoped that this money would be enough to “really move the needle” in terms of making progress on treating and preventing Parkinson’s. (For reference, at that time, Brin’s net worth was around $15 billion.)
But Brin didn’t stop there. He wanted to lower his risk to under 10 percent. Although ten percent is still ten times higher than the average risk, it is a five-fold reduction from his original risk (i.e., from 50% down to 10%), which is much better than having a coin toss’s chance of getting the disease.
One of my doctor friends once said that patients don’t need to hand over their destiny to doctors. He meant that the real responsibility for one’s body belongs to the patient, not his or her doctor. The role of doctors is to provide professional opinions for the patient’s reference.
“I lucky know early in my life something I am substantially predisposed to,” Brin wrote. “I now have the opportunity to adjust my life to reduce those odds. I also have the opportunity to perform and support research into this disease long before it may affect me. And, regardless of my own health, it can help my family members as well as others.”
Of course, it’s possible that Brin wouldn’t get Parkinson’s even if he didn’t do anything. But we probably shouldn’t think that way. It's likely better to assume that the worst will happen if we don’t do anything. Doing so will help to motivate us to try to reduce the risk or at least delay the onset. That way, we won’t have any regrets, even if we do get sick.
Brin is fortunate in the sense that he has money to donate and because he found out about his genetic predisposition so early. However, all of us have conditions in our lives that could be improved or better accommodated in some way with effort on our part. And with the Internet, almost anyone can do a certain level of research and find experts with opinions on the maladies or situations that may affect us.
Brin demonstrated an aggressive and proactive attitude in facing his potential disease. We can learn from his example when we are facing potential problems and also actual problems. We should try to estimate the risk and do everything that we can to lower the risk. Similarly, if we can do anything to increase the probability of success, we should do so in order to improve our lives. In conclusion, a concerted effort on our part can go a long way in terms of avoiding a problem or increasing our likelihood of success.
